- Released by the Chicago Cubs. (March 2010)
- Major league baseball player with the Florida Marlins (1998-2002), Boston Red Sox (2003-2005), Baltimore Orioles (2006-2008), and Toronto Blue Jays (2009).
- Made major league debut on 11 April 1998.
- Twins Kashten Charles (boy) & Kiley Faith (girl), born on April 27, 2005.
- Attended Lamar University in Beaumont, Texas
- Won the 2004 World Series while with the Red Sox.
- Got the infamous walk off Mariano Rivera in Game 4 of the 2004 ALCS, Yankees at the Red Sox. Dave Roberts went on to pinch-run for Millar, steal second, and score to tie the game at 4-4. Of course the Red Sox went on to win the game off a David Ortiz home run..
- NESN released a commercial in early 2003 about newcomers Kevin Millar and Bill Mueller. The commercial featured a song explaining how to pronounce each of their last names.
- Coined the phrase "Cowboy Up" while with the Red Sox in 2003.
- Son Kanyon Edward, born September 25, 2006.
- (January 12) Agreed to a $2.1 million, one-year contract with the Baltimore Orioles. (2006)
- Signed to a minor league contract by the Toronto Blue Jays with an invitation to spring training. (February 2009)
- Inducted into the Lamar University Baseball Players Association (LUBPA) Hall of Fame in 2017 (inaugural class).
